First of all, thank you, Bartleboom. As for the title... I don’t know, I think it was simply chosen to create buzz and build anticipation among the fans. I repeat, musically speaking, there’s a real change compared to the previous two works and Powerplant. You can hear more refined melodies, pompous and carefree in the style of Gamma Ray, less angry than before (goodbye No World Order and Majestic). However, this doesn’t justify the title Land of the Free II, as only the suite recalls Part I (Rebellion in Dreamland in particular, without reaching its peaks).
